The English Premier League outfit Man United have been linked with a move for Everton midfielder Idrissa Gueye ahead of the summer transfer window as it is claimed that his presence will help to bring the best out of France international Paul Pogba in the coming season.
Paul Pogba has been linked away from the Old Trafford for the past week as it is understood that he is no longer interested in a stay at the club.
The former Juventus midfielder has been linked with a return to Turin while French Ligue 1 outfit Paris Saint Germain are still keen but there are indications that he has his mind set on moving to the Spanish La Liga outfit Real Madrid, especially after he declared his wish to play under football legend Zinedine Zidane.
However, the Red Devils are doing all it takes to keep the star player with all efforts to lure him into staying which is the reason why a move for Idrissa Gueye is being considered with claims that he will bring the best out of the World Cup winner.
Idrissa Gueye has been highly rated in the English Premier League, having impressed with Everton this season but it is reported that he seeks a move away from the club especially after handing a transfer request to Everton in the last January transfer window.
The French Ligue 1 outfit Paris Saint Germain were also keen on his signature and that was supposed to be his destination but the move was blocked by Everton.
It is, therefore, suggested that Idrissa Gueye will also fancy a move to the Old Trafford in the coming summer window.
